Introduction: When choosing a VPS for a game server or acceleration node, the question “Which is better, a VPS from Korea or Hong Kong?” is a common one. This article compares the advantages and disadvantages of Korean VPS and Hong Kong VPS from aspects such as latency, routing, bandwidth, user distribution, and operational compliance, providing practical recommendations for the Asia-Pacific region to help in making data-driven deployment decisions.
Relative geographical location Korean VPS Generally, players from the Korean Peninsula, as well as those from Japan and South Korea, have a natural advantage, as the round-trip latency is lower for them ; Hong Kong VPS covers the southern part of mainland China, Southeast Asia, and numerous international submarine fiber optic cable nodes, making it ideal for access from multiple countries. When making choices, priority should be given to the distribution of main players and the core interconnected links, in order to avoid decisions being influenced by a single indicator alone.
The gaming experience depends on low latency and stable routing, rather than simply the physical distance between data centers. Which is better, a VPS from South Korea or Hong Kong, depends on the backbone routing used by the provider to reach the target players, as well as the packet loss rates and peak bandwidth performance. Prioritizing the verification of the next-hop routing and ISP peering connections, as well as focusing on anti-jitter and packet loss recovery mechanisms, is essential for truly enhancing the effects of game acceleration.
If most users in the Asia-Pacific region are located in Japan and South Korea, then South Korean VPS providers usually offer shorter network routes ; If players are distributed across southern China, Southeast Asia, and international regions, Hong Kong VPS may have an advantage due to its multiple undersea cable connections and broader connectivity. It is recommended to prioritize nodes based on actual access logs and the proportion of regional traffic.
When selecting a VPS node, it is important to consider the upstream bandwidth capacity, peak limits, and the way traffic is billed. While specific prices or brands are not discussed here, it is important to verify whether the provider supports sudden spikes in game traffic, whether there are clear limits on data speeds, and whether they offer reasonable DDoS protection and traffic filtering measures. All these factors directly affect the stability of the service and the cost-effectiveness of its use.
Legal and compliance requirements also play a role in determining which is better between Korean and Hong Kong VPS services. Different jurisdictions have varying requirements regarding data storage, security audits, and content regulation. If the business involves sensitive data or is subject to regional legal restrictions, it is essential to prioritize the assessment of compliance risks and operational controllability of the data centers involved, in order to avoid potential limitations later on.
For a wide range of users in the Asia-Pacific region, it is recommended to use a hybrid or multi-node deployment approach: Lightweight nodes are deployed in both South Korea and Hong Kong, and load balancing or intelligent DNS is used to route requests based on the users' geographical locations. This strategy allows for both low latency in Japan and South Korea, as well as good connectivity with Southeast Asia and the international community, thereby enhancing overall access stability and disaster recovery capabilities.
A proper assessment should be conducted before making a decision: Collect Ping, Traceroute, packet loss rate, jitter, and bandwidth test data from the target area, and measure peak performance at different times. By combining player experience feedback with log analysis, we can quantify the impact of “which is better, Korean or Hong Kong VPSs” on actual game latency and stability, thus avoiding decisions based on mere impressions.
Summary and Recommendations: Overall, if the main players are located in Japan or South Korea, it would be preferable to use a South Korean VPS ; If it is intended to serve users in South China, Southeast Asia, and internationally, Hong Kong-based VPS solutions offer better connectivity. Best practices involve testing based on access data, adopting a multi-node hybrid deployment, and paying attention to routing quality, bandwidth policies, and compliance risks. This enables balanced decisions when considering game acceleration and the distribution of users in the Asia-Pacific region.
